Bio
2022-2023: Tirulli landed in first during the 200-yard butterfly timed finals at the South Atlantic Conference Championships with a time of 2:06.15 and placed third in the finals in 2:05.80. She also won gold in the event against Emory & Henry and Lees-McCrae during the season. At the Emory Invitational, Tirulli placed third in the 200 fly with a time of 2:07.29. Tirulli placed first in the 100-yard butterfly against Milligan in 58.16 as well as taking first against Emory & Henry earlier in the season, adding to her total of 18 top-5 finishes on the year.
2021-2022: Finished top-5 in the Bluegrass Mountain Conference Championships in the 200-yard butterfly.
High School: Tiruli placed 2nd at the Junior Brazilian Nationals in the 200-meter butterfly. She finished top-10 in the 2018 Brazilian Nationals in the 200-meter butterfly and top-8 in 2019. In 2021, Tiruli placed 3rd at the Senior Brazilian Nationals in the same event.
Personal: Daughter of Ricardo José Tirulli and Claudinéia Felix, Tiruli intends to major in Sports Science at Carson-Newman.
